LONGEVILLE-LèS-METZ. Paris Saint Germain bested Metz to win 2-1. A. Hakimi was the key to score 2 goals. It was Paris Saint Germain to strike first with an early goal of A. Hakimi at the 5′. Then it was a goal in the 39′ minute to make things even for 1-1. Eventually, A. Hakimi gave the win to Paris Saint Germain in the 90′ minute with a goal scoring a double. Its vastly superior ball possession (74%) was among the key factors of its victory.
Also, Metz had 2 players sent off: D. Bronn (90′ for a double yellow card) and F. Antonetti (90′ for a red card).
The match was played at the Stade Saint-Symphorien stadium in Longeville-lès-Metz on Wednesday and it started at 7:00 pm local time. The referee was Jérémie Pignard with the assistance of Laurent Coniglio and Mehdi Rahmouni. The 4th official was Eddy Rosier.
